Master’s Student Diversity

In the most recent graduating class, 12% of health professions master’s degrees went to men and 88% went to women.

Marywood gender breakdown of Health Professions Master's degree grads The largest share of health professions master’s degree graduates at Marywood were White. Roughly 65% of graduates fell into this category.

The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Marywood University with a master’s in health professions.

Ethnic diversity of Health Professions majors at Marywood University
Ethnic Background Number of Students
Asian 2
Black or African American 1
Hispanic or Latino 2
White 74
Non-Resident Aliens 4
Other Races 30
